Description

Cable immobilizing structure
Technical field
The utility model relates to connector technique fields, and in particular to a kind of cable immobilizing structure.
Background technique
Cross line card seat class connector construction at present and be mainly that metallic shield pressing sleeve is crimped with cable, but metalwork not with Shell is fixed, and there are problems that cable can be rotated and play causes sealed ring deformation so as to cause seal failure.And have Structure also additionally increase play the role of ripple spring play shielding conducting, there are problems that ripple spring is easily fallen in transport process.
Utility model content
The purpose of this utility model is to provide a kind of cable immobilizing structures that can effectively avoid cable rotation and play.
The technical solution that the utility model solves above-mentioned technical problem is as follows: cable immobilizing structure, including the first shielding pressure The secondary shielding pressing sleeve cover, being mounted on the first shielding pressing sleeve and the shell being coupled with the first shielding pressing sleeve;The shell The hanging platform with the first shielding pressing sleeve cooperation is provided on body;
The clamping that the first shielding pressing sleeve includes the mounting portion being coupled with secondary shielding pressing sleeve, is connected with mounting portion Portion and the bending part and elastic claw for being arranged on clamping portion and matching with shell, the bending part are located at clamping portion far from installation The one end in portion, and end bending and the direction clamping portion of the bending part;Hanging platform on the elastic claw and shell is cooperatively connected.
Further, the bending part include the linkage section being connected on clamping portion and with linkage section be connected bending section, The bending section is directed toward the center of clamping portion.
Further, it is connected with installation panel on the first shielding pressing sleeve, offers inner hole on the installation panel, And the inner hole is matched with the bending section of the clamping portion.
Further, card slot compatible with elastic claw size is offered on the clamping portion.
Further, the bending part is multiple, and is uniformly arranged on the end of clamping portion.
The utility model has the following beneficial effects: a kind of cable immobilizing structure provided by the utility model, passes through One shielding pressing sleeve, secondary shielding pressing sleeve crimp the first shielding to which the first shielding pressing sleeve and cable be fixed together with cable After pressing sleeve is packed into shell, elastic claw is flicked and is hung on the hanging platform of shell, so that the first shielding pressing sleeve of limitation turns relative to shell Dynamic and axial float to the left, and bending part limitation the first shielding pressing sleeve of the first shielding pressing sleeve is axially altered to the right relative to shell Dynamic, avoiding cable rotation and play leads to the hidden danger of seal failure;It is convenient and efficient, securely and reliably.

Specific embodiment
The principles of the present invention and feature are described below in conjunction with attached drawing, example is served only for explaining that this is practical It is novel, it is not intended to limit the scope of the utility model.
As shown in Figures 1 to 4, cable immobilizing structure, including installation panel 11, the first screen matched with installation panel 11 Cover pressing sleeve 1, the secondary shielding pressing sleeve 2 being mounted on the first shielding pressing sleeve 1 and the shell being coupled with the first shielding pressing sleeve 1 3;The hanging platform 4 cooperated with the first shielding pressing sleeve 1 is provided on shell 3.It is inside first shielding pressing sleeve 1, secondary shielding pressing sleeve 2 Cavity structure, the first shielding pressing sleeve 1 are assemblied in the cavity of secondary shielding pressing sleeve 2, pass through the first shielding pressing sleeve 1, secondary shielding Pressing sleeve 2 crimps for the first shielding pressing sleeve 1 to be fixed together with cable 10 with cable 10.
First shielding pressing sleeve 1 includes the mounting portion 5 being coupled with secondary shielding pressing sleeve 2, the clamping connected with mounting portion 5 Portion 6 and the bending part 7 and elastic claw 8 for being arranged on clamping portion 6 and matching with shell 3, it is separate that bending part 7 is located at clamping portion 6 One end of mounting portion 5, and end bending and the direction clamping portion 6 of bending part 7;Hanging platform 4 on elastic claw 8 and shell 3 is cooperatively connected. Mounting portion 5 is coupled with secondary shielding pressing sleeve 2, and clamping portion 6 is matched with shell 3, and elastic claw 8 is located at about 6 two sides of clamping portion, After clamping portion 6 is packed into shell 3, the hanging platform 4 on elastic claw 8 and shell 3 cooperates, so that limitation the first shielding pressing sleeve 1 is relative to shell The rotation of body 3 and axial float to the left;And cooperated by bending part 7 and shell 3, thus limitation the first shielding 1 phase of pressing sleeve For the axial float to the right of shell 3, effectively avoiding the rotation of cable 10 and play leads to the hidden danger of seal failure.
In order to guarantee connector and install the reliability of panel shielding conducting, the bending section 602 on clamping portion 6 has bullet Property, and it is at regular intervals with clamping portion 6, when connector is packed into 11 inner hole 12 of mounting surface plate, bending section 602 is elastic to clamping portion 6 Deformation, the inner hole 12 of bending section 602 and installation panel 11 keeps Elastic Contact after the assembly is completed, it is ensured that this connector and installation The reliability of the shielding conducting of panel 11.
For the ease of the cooperation between elastic claw 8 and shell 3, in the utility model, offered on clamping portion 6 big with elastic claw 8 Small compatible card slot 9.Elastic claw 8 has elasticity, and when the first shielding pressing sleeve 1 is during being packed into shell 3, elastic claw 8 is pressed In card slot 9, when at 4 position of hanging platform that elastic claw 8 reaches shell 3,8 automatic spring of elastic claw is clasped with hanging platform 4, thus Avoid rotation and axial float to the left of the first shielding pressing sleeve 1 relative to shell 3.
The above are specific embodiment of the present utility model, from implementation process as can be seen that provided by the utility model A kind of cable immobilizing structure, by the first shielding pressing sleeve, secondary shielding pressing sleeve crimp with cable to by first shield pressing sleeve and Cable is fixed together, and after the first shielding pressing sleeve is packed into shell, elastic claw is flicked and hung on the hanging platform of shell, thus limitation first Shield rotation and to the left axial float, and the bending part limitation first shielding pressing sleeve of first shielding pressing sleeve of the pressing sleeve relative to shell Relative to shell axial float to the right, avoiding cable rotation and play leads to the hidden danger of seal failure;It is convenient and efficient, safely may be used It leans on.
